Output e2862af7e9cfd6bef1b7edfac4e491293a801b45fa6b7c2453f9e62593d6f9c1:169

value
318878
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dedf7aec2231f8f090244a2cdad7f27aa788383e OP_EQUAL
address
3N1TeobgzoTBpdP3GTUW2Wbwm9yGAwURbS
transaction
e2862af7e9cfd6bef1b7edfac4e491293a801b45fa6b7c2453f9e62593d6f9c1
confirmations
126438
spent
true